The recipe for perpetual ignorance is be satisfied with your opinions and content with your knowledge.
Elbert Hubbard
To know when to be generous and when to be firm - - This is wisdom.
Elbert Hubbard
A friend is someone who knows all about you and loves you just the same.
Elbert Hubbard
A committee is a thing which takes a week to do what one good man can do in an hour.
Elbert Hubbard
Live truth instead of professing it.
Elbert Hubbard

Optimism is a kind of heart stimulant - - The digitalis of failure.
Elbert Hubbard
How many a man has thrown up his hands at a time when a little more effort, a little more patience would have achieved success?
Elbert Hubbard
The reason men oppose progress is not that they hate progress, but that they love inertia.
Elbert Hubbard
Life in abundance comes only through great love.
Elbert Hubbard
Gossip is only the lack of a worthy memory.
Elbert Hubbard
The greatest mistake you can make in life is to be continually fearing you will make one.
Elbert Hubbard
The idea that is not dangerous is not worthy of being called an idea at all.
Elbert Hubbard
Every man is a damn fool for at least five minutes every day wisdom consists of not exceeding the limit.
Elbert Hubbard
The man who is anybody and who does anything is surely going to be criticized, vilified, and misunderstood. That is part of the penalty for greatness, and every great man understands it; and understands, too, that it is no proof of greatness. The final proof of greatness lies in being able to endure continously without resentment.
Elbert Hubbard
Religions are many and diverse, but reason and goodness are one.
Elbert Hubbard
To avoid criticism, do nothing, say nothing and be nothing.
Elbert Hubbard
We are punished by our sins, not for them.
Elbert Hubbard
Genius may have its limitations, but stupidity is not thus handicapped.
Elbert Hubbard
Folks who never do any more than they are paid for, never get paid more than they do.
Elbert Hubbard
An ounce of loyalty is worth a pound of cleverness.
Elbert Hubbard
A pessimist is a man who has been compelled to live with an optimist.
Elbert Hubbard
The secret of success is this: there is no secret of success.
Elbert Hubbard
The woman who cannot tell a lie in defense of her husband is unworthy of the name of wife.
Elbert Hubbard
The ineffable joy of forgiving and being forgiven forms an ecstasy that might well arouse the envy of the gods.
Elbert Hubbard
The artist needs no religion beyond his work.
Elbert Hubbard
There is something that is much more scarce, something finer far, something rarer than ability. It is the ability to recognize ability.
Elbert Hubbard
Life is just one damned thing after another.
Elbert Hubbard
Death: To stop sinning suddenly.
Elbert Hubbard
Editor: a person employed by a newspaper, whose business it is to separate the wheat from the chaff, and to see that the chaff is printed.
Elbert Hubbard
Men are rich only as they give. He who gives great service gets great rewards.
Elbert Hubbard
Get happiness out of your work or you may never know what happiness is.
Elbert Hubbard
If pleasures are greatest in anticipation, just remember that this is also true of trouble.
Elbert Hubbard
A conservative is a man who is too cowardly to fight and too fat to run.
Elbert Hubbard
